2101101001003 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 2101101001004. Its totient is φ = 2101101001002.

The previous prime is 2101101000983. The next prime is 2101101001019. The reversal of 2101101001003 is 3001001011012.

It is a strong prime.

It is a cyclic number.

It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-2101101001003 is a prime.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(2101101001903)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 1050550500501 + 1050550500502.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(1050550500502).

Almost surely, 22101101001003 is an apocalyptic number.

2101101001003 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).

2101101001003 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

2101101001003 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 6, while the sum is 10.

Adding to 2101101001003 its reverse (3001001011012), we get a palindrome (5102102012015).

The spelling of 2101101001003 in words is "two trillion, one hundred one billion, one hundred one million, one thousand, three".
